- Reporting and Development
- Design, develop, and maintain Power BI reports, dashboards, and paginated reports.
- Dataflows and Shared Datasets
- Create and maintain dataflows and shared datasets to support enterprise reporting.
- Data Modelling & Architecture
- Build and optimise Power BI semantic models, including star schemas, relationships, measures, and row‑level security.
- Apply dimensional modelling principles to support analytical workloads.
- Work with data engineers to design and document technical solutions.
- Ensure interoperability with the wider data platform.
- Operational Support & Estate Management
- Maintain the day‑to‑day running of the Force's Power BI estate, including workspace management, dataset refresh monitoring, gateway oversight, and performance optimisation.
- Ensure all developments adhere to Force processes, security standards, and testing requirements.
- Stakeholder Engagement & Requirements Gathering
- Engage with business stakeholders to gather, document, and validate business requirements.
- Produce Business Requirements Documents (BRDs).
- Support the Force Performance Management Team in data visualisation and insight delivery.
- Dev Ops & Delivery Processes
- Create, update, and manage Dev Ops work items (user stories, tasks, bugs).
- Contribute to version control, deployment pipelines, and release processes.
- Research & Continuous Improvement
- Keep abreast of technological advances in Power BI, Microsoft Fabric, and related BI technologies.
- Evaluate and recommend tools, standards, and practices to support BI capability development.
- Documentation
- Produce and maintain business requirement documents, technical design documents, implementation notes, and user guides.
